포털 플레이북 위젯

  • 릴리스 버전: Australia
  • 업데이트 날짜 2026년 03월 12일
  • 소요 시간: 3분
  • 포털 플레이북 위젯 탐색.

    위젯 정보

    플레이북 위젯은 관리자가 플레이북 이벤트를 보내야 하는 위치를 지정할 수 있는 iFrame입니다. iFrame URL은 플레이북 포털 페이지입니다 UI 빌더 . 위젯은 플레이북이 세션 스토리지 API를 통해 수신 대기 중인 이벤트를 처리하여 포털에서 작업을 수행할 때(예: 내부 모달에서 기록 또는 목록을 여는 경우) 를 알 수 있습니다 서비스 포털.

    바로 사용 가능한 구성요소는 사용자에게 필요한 서비스 포털 모든 플레이북 경험 것을 위해 빌드되었습니다. 바로 사용 UI 빌더 가능한 플레이북 포털 페이지, 서비스 포털 플레이북 위젯 또는 플레이북 콘텐츠 항목을 직접 편집하지 않는 것이 좋습니다. 바로 사용 가능 구성요소를 변경하면 기술적인 문제가 발생할 수 있습니다.

    예를 들어 플레이북 페이지의 인스턴스에서 작동하기 위해 UXF 클라이언트 작업이 필요한 경우 대신 플레이북 위젯을 복제하는 것이 좋습니다.

    주:
    대신 사용자 고유의 위젯을 복제하거나 생성하는 방법에 대한 자세한 내용은 을 참조하십시오 Developing custom widgets.

    플레이북 서비스 포털 위젯 복제

    다음으로 이동 모두 > 서비스 포털 > 위젯 을 클릭하고 플레이북 위젯을 찾습니다.
    주:
    플레이북 위젯을 복제하는 경우 바로 사용 가능한 모든 작업과 구성 속성이 복제된 위젯에 복사되었는지 확인합니다.
    표 1. 양식 필드
    필드 설명
    이름 복제된 위젯의 이름을 입력합니다.
    ID 위젯 ID는 기본적으로 위젯 이름을 기반으로 자동으로 생성되지만 원하는 대로 변경할 수 있습니다.
    설명 위젯에 대한 상세 정보를 제공하는 설명(선택 사항)을 추가합니다.
    애플리케이션 위젯을 실행할 애플리케이션 범위를 선택합니다. 전역을 선택하면 모든 애플리케이션 범위에서 실행할 수 플레이북 있습니다. 자세한 내용은 애플리케이션 범위를 참조하십시오.
    공개 위젯이 공개인 경우 선택합니다. 선택하지 않으면 위젯이 비공개이며 snc_internal 또는 snc_external 역할을 가진 인증된 사용자만 위젯을 볼 수 있습니다.
    역할 위젯에 대한 액세스를 특정 역할로 제한합니다.
    본문 HTML 템플릿 Angular JS 양방향 바인딩을 활용하여 컨트롤러 변수를 마크업에 바인딩합니다.
    위험:
    고급 코딩 지식과 AngularJS 및 플랫폼 API에 대한 확고한 이해가 있는 경우에만 HTML 템플릿을 변경하십시오.
    iFrame URL은 페이지의 URL입니다.UI 빌더 HTML 템플릿 필드에 대한 자세한 내용은 다음 문서를 참조하십시오 Developing custom widgets.
    경고:
    복제된 위젯의 iFrame URL이 바로 사용 가능한 위젯의 iFrame URL과 달라야 합니다.
    CSS 위젯 CSS를 구성합니다. 실제 위젯에서 CSS를 구성하면 해당 위젯의 모든 인스턴스에 영향을 줍니다. CSS 필드에 대한 자세한 내용은 다음 문서를 참조하십시오 Developing custom widgets.
    서버 스크립트 서버 측 논리를 스크립팅합니다. 이는 주로 서버 측 API를 통해 Glide 플랫폼과 상호 작용할 때 유용합니다.
    위험:
    서버 스크립트에서 기록 데이터를 사용하려면 ServiceNow API에 대한 지식이 필요합니다.
    서버 스크립트 필드에 대한 자세한 내용은 다음 문서를 참조하십시오 Developing custom widgets.
    클라이언트 컨트롤러 Angular에서 HTML 템플릿에는 Angular 관련 요소와 속성이 포함되어 있습니다. Angular는 템플릿을 모델 및 클라이언트 컨트롤러의 정보와 결합하여 사용자가 브라우저에서 보는 동적 보기를 렌더링합니다. 지침 범위 내에서 컨트롤러에 대한 참조의 식별자 이름
    위험:
    클라이언트 스크립트에서 클라이언트 컨트롤러를 생성하려면 ServiceNow API와 AngularJS에 대한 지식이 모두 필요합니다.
    컨트롤러로서 HTML 템플릿은 기본 바인딩에 controllerAs 구문을 사용합니다.
    링크 링크 함수를 사용하여 DOM을 직접 조작합니다.
    위험:
    링크 함수에는 AngularJS에 대한 지식이 필요합니다.
    링크 필드에 대한 자세한 내용은 다음 문서를 참조하십시오 Developing custom widgets.
    미리 보기 있음 위젯 편집기에서 위젯 미리 보기를 활성화하는 옵션을 선택합니다.
    데모 데이터 위젯 편집기에서 위젯을 미리 볼 때 데이터를 제공합니다.
    데이터 테이블 데이터 소스로 사용할 테이블을 선택합니다.
    필드 인스턴스 옵션으로 표시할 필드를 선택합니다.
    옵션 스키마 관리자가 서비스 포털 위젯을 구성할 수 있도록 허용합니다. 옵션 스키마 필드 Widget option schema에 대한 자세한 내용을 보려면
    Docs 설명서 링크를 선택합니다 서비스 포털 .

    플레이북 경험 포털 페이지 구성 및 이벤트 속성에 UI 빌더 오류가 있는지 확인합니다(예: 유지관리 사용자로서 기록 열기 이벤트 비활성화).